## SEC. 10105 NATIONAL ORGANIC CERTIFICATION COST-SHARE PROGRAM ###
(a)Elimination of Directed Delegation Section 10606(a) of the Farm Security and Rural Investment Act of 2002 (7 U.S.C. 6523(a)) is amended by striking “(acting through the Agricultural Marketing Service)”. ###
(b)Funding Section 10606 of the Farm Security and Rural Investment Act of 2002 (7 U.S.C. 6523) is amended by striking subsection
(d)and inserting the following: > > ### “(d) Mandatory Funding > > > #### “(1) In general > > Of the funds of the Commodity Credit Corporation, the Secretary shall make available to carry out this section— > > > ##### “(A) > > $2,000,000 for each of fiscal years 2019 and 2020; > > > ##### “(B) > > $4,000,000 for fiscal year 2021; and > > > ##### “(C) > > $8,000,000 for each of fiscal years 2022 and 2023. > > > #### “(2) Availability > > Amounts made available under paragraph
(1)shall remain available until expended.” > .
